Propriedades dos Estilos

O CrappUIStyleData é composto basicamente dos seguintes elementos:

  • color e on_color: Gerenciados via CrappUIStyleColorData, definem a cor principal (normalmente utilizada para backgrounds) e a cor de destaque ou "on" (usada para colorir elementos que se sobrepõem a cor principal).

  • font_family e font_weight: Vêm do CrappUIStyleFontData e determinam a família tipográfica e o peso da fonte, que pode ser convertido para o formato esperado pela API de fonte.

  • size e space: Definem a escala (tamanho) e o espaçamento do componente. A propriedade space normalmente é utilizada para definir margens ou distâncias entre elementos.

  • corners e on_focus_weight: Configuram a arredondamento dos cantos e o quanto a cor deve ser modificada quando o componente está em foco.

  • prevent_border: Uma flag que permite desabilitar a renderização de bordas em certos componentes.

Atualizado

Isto foi útil?